001, XP, 6.1 here we go again...Heeelllpppp
I had sought help on this about a month ago or so, when I first tried to install 6.1. I was runing XP pro with 5.3.1 and was fine. along comes 6.1 Great, most of the short cuts are the same as TDM saves me a heap of trouble. Try to load..... problems. Try to reload it appears to not see the hardware It begins and then pooof. after much discussion It was thought by some that perhaps since XP was an upgrade maybe there was the flaw. Re loaded all still nothing. Now I have just purchased a new XP pro installed it activated it tried to load 6.1 and...... Poof OK folks now what. That was my last ditch hope, reload a fresh new OS that was not an upgrade , but a complete install reloaded 6.1 and..... Poof! Heeeellllpppp
I've been using PT and PTLE almost since it's inception and never had any thing like this. SYS: ASUS AV8X7 deluxe 512 corsair RAM two Maxtor 80 Gig drives one app one audio G550 AGP card enermax 420 smart power PSU in a rack case. what else can I be doing? Please help DIGI? anybody? N-G-NEER |

Re: 001, XP, 6.1 here we go again...Heeelllpppp
First thing I'd do is run out and purchase Symantec's Norton's Ghost utility so you can easily re-image your computer in the shortest possible time instead of having to reload the OS again from the CD. If it's not detecting the hardware I would first reseat the Digi001 interface card as well as the external cable. Here's where Ghost comes in had you been able to use it. You could have reverted back to your 5.3.1 image (created by Ghost) and made sure you hardware was detected properly at least so you know your hardware was fuctioning correctly. I'm assuming you haven't reconfigured your machine (moved cards around) prior to this upgrade correct? If the reseating mentioned above still doesn't work, then try bouncing the 001 interface card to a different slot. Hope this helps.
